Troubleshooting: Longhorn-UI: Error during WebSocket handshake: Unexpected response code: 200 #2265

| March 9, 2021

Applicable versions

Existing Longhorn versions < v1.1.0 upgrade to Longhorn >= v1.1.0.

Symptoms

After upgrading Longhorn to version >= v1.1.0, the following is encountered:

Ingress messages:

{"level":"error","msg":"vulcand/oxy/forward/websocket: Error dialing \"10.17.1.246\": websocket: bad handshake with resp: 200 200 OK","time":"2021-03-09T08:29:03Z"}

Longhorn UI messages:

Reason

To support different routing (Rancher-Proxy, NodePort, Ingress, and Ngnix), Longhorn v1.1.0 has restructured the UI to use hash history for two reasons:

  • To support Longhorn UI routing to different paths. e.g., /longhorn/#/dashboard
  • To support single-page application by disassociating frontend and backend.

As result, <LONGHORN_URL>/<TAG> changes to <LONGHORN_URL>/#/<TAG>.

Solution

  1. Clear browser cache.
  2. Access/Rebookmark Longhorn URL from <LONGHORN_URL>/#.
